A common misunderstanding amongst foreigners relocating to Spain is that they can easily order strong prescription pain relievers through an online pharmacy or a devoted "Spain painkiller site."
It is important to comprehend Spanish law concerning online pharmaceutical sales:
- Legal Online Pharmacies: Authorized physical drug stores in Spain are lawfully allowed to offer non-prescription (OTC) medications online. They should show the official European typical logo design for online pharmacies.
- Prescription Medications Online: By Spanish and European Union law, prescription-only medications (consisting of strong pain relievers, codeine, and high-dose NSAIDs) can not be offered online. They need a physical or electronic prescription released by a certified doctor practicing within the EU.
Therefore, any website claiming to deliver strong opioids or restricted pain relievers to your door in Spain without a prescription is operating unlawfully and likely offering counterfeit or unsafe substances.
How to Legally Access Pain Relief in Spain
For those experiencing acute or persistent pain while in Spain, there are safe, legal pathways to receive suitable treatment without resorting to unproven web vendors.
sip (Tarjeta Sanitaria Individual)
If you are a resident registered in the general public health care system, you will have a SIP card. This grants you access to public physicians (médicos de cabecera) who can assess your pain, recommend the necessary medication, and submit the prescription straight to your digital health file. You merely provide your health card at any pharmacy.
Private Healthcare
For travelers or homeowners who prefer faster gain access to, personal medical insurance (such as Sanitas, Adeslas, or AXA) or paying out-of-pocket for a personal assessment is a popular path.
- Personal assessments generally cost in between EUR40 and EUR80.
- Physicians can provide private prescriptions (receta privada), which are honored at all Spanish drug stores.
Farmacia de Guardia
If you experience sudden pain beyond regular company hours, Spain uses a rotating system of duty drug stores (farmacias de guardia). A minimum of one drug store in every district stays open 24/7 or late into the night.

- Check the Dosage: Do not assume dosages are the exact same as in your home nation. For circumstances, while 400mg ibuprofen is sold nonprescription, the typically recommended 600mg dose needs a medical professional's authorization.
- Bring a Supply for Travel: If you experience persistent pain and take specific prescription medications, travel with a letter from your doctor and an enough supply of medication in its initial, labeled packaging to cover your trip.
- Validate Online Pharmacies: If you are purchasing legal OTC products online (like vitamins, skin care, or low-dose pain reducers), constantly check for the main green and white EU online pharmacy confirmation seal.
